2:00 – The Bluesman
I kick the day off on The Bluesman, and he’s a horse who hasn’t really done much wrong lately. He was quite impressive the last day at Haydock, and he seems to be progressing nicely.
This is obviously a big step up in class, and he’ll need to improve again to be competitive in a race like this. I’ll aim to ride him quite patiently, which should suit him on the New Course at Cheltenham better than the Old Course, with that long straight to run into.
If we can get him settled early and pick up the pieces late on, I wouldn’t be surprised if he could run into a place. In races like these at the Festival, if things fall right and you’re finishing strongly up the hill, anything can happen.
4:00 – Banbridge
The big ride of the day for me is Banbridge in the Ryanair Chase, and I’m really looking forward to getting back on him.
His run in the King George VI Chase at Kempton was a fantastic effort. I thought he travelled really strongly that day and his jumping was excellent. That sort of performance shows the ability he has.
The Ryanair trip and track should suit him very well. He’s a horse who travels strongly through his races, and Cheltenham’s stiff finish will play to his strengths if he’s in a good position turning for home.
Of course, Fact To File looks like the one to beat. He’s a top-class horse, but we’ve got a good one ourselves. If he turns up in the same form he showed at Kempton, he’s entitled to run a very big race.
4:40 – Ikarak
My final ride of the day is Ikarak in the Pertemps Network Final.
He’s qualified for the race by winning two of his last three starts. I rode him to victory over 3m at Ayr earlier this year and he produced an excellent run.
He’s owned by a big syndicate, so it’ll be a brilliant day out for them having a runner at the Festival. These races can be very competitive, but if he can travel well and give them a good spin around, he can give them something to cheer about.
